Transaction 5dcb4a804c4e03c81c87a2fa26693a5c80c1abc0f13691922d5e4d082db54546
1 Input
1 Output
-
5dcb4a804c4e03c81c87a2fa26693a5c80c1abc0f13691922d5e4d082db54546:0
- value
- 3423535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d601f3923b4525578009271e2ceb84d78ecf88a OP_EQUAL
- address
- 3EaYMGDKbdHuHzciU3E3uz4uqrdZhVRYED